About Southern Company
The Southern Company, through its subsidiaries, engages in the generation, transmission, and distribution of electricity. The company develops, constructs, acquires, owns, and manages power generation assets, including renewable energy projects and sells electricity in the wholesale market; distributes natural gas in Illinois, Georgia, Virginia, and Tennessee; operates, constructs, and maintains approximately 78,500 miles of natural gas pipelines and 14 storage facilities; and provides gas marketing services, as well as electric services to retail customers. It also offers distributed energy and resilience solutions, and digital wireless communications and fiber optics services, as well as deploys microgrids for commercial, industrial, governmental, utility customers. The Southern Company was incorporated in 1946 and is head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ia.

Dividend
Southern Company pays out a dividend of $2.95 per share, with a dividend yield of 3.31%.
SO's next dividend payment will be made to shareholders on December 8, 2025.
They pay out 71.61% of their earnings out as a dividend.
